The area’s girls basketball programs learned of their first-round postseason fates Sunday afternoon as the Southeast Ohio District Athletic Board revealed tournament seeds.
Here’s a brief look at where each area team will begin its postseason run.
NOTE: All sectional tournament games are hosted by the highest seeded team.
DIVISION I
Leading the area’s Division I teams is No. 14 Teays Valley (14-5), who will play host to Hilliard Bradley at 7 p.m. on Feb. 15. in a sectional semifinal. The winner of that game will play No. 23 Chillicothe (13-5) in a sectional championship at 1 p.m., Feb. 18.
Meanwhile, No. 35 Logan (4-14) travels to Newark at 7 p.m. on Feb. 15.
DIVISION II
The area’s top-seeded team in Division II is Fairland (18-0). The Dragons will host either No. 16 Washington (3-16) or No. 17 Hillsboro (3-16), who play on Feb. 13, in a sectional final Feb. 16.
Meanwhile, No. 18 Gallia Academy (2-18) will travel to No. 15 Vinton County (4-14) in a sectional semifinal on Feb. 13 at 7 p.m.
Elsewhere, No. 9 Waverly (12-6) will travel to No. 8 Circleville (14-5), No. 13 McClain (6-13) will go to Marietta, No. 12 Fairfield Union (7-9) goes to Warren, No. 2 Unioto (18-0) hosts either Vinton County or Gallia, No. 10 Miami Trace (11-8) will pay a visit to New Lexington, No. 14 Logan Elm (4-15) will make a trip to Sheridan, and No. 11 Athens (11-7) will meet with No. 6 Jackson (14-3).
Those matchups, all of which are sectional championship games, will take place at 7 p.m. on Feb. 16.
In the Central District, No. 5 Bloom-Carroll (12-7) will host London in a sectional final at 1 p.m. on Feb. 18.
DIVISION III
The top-seeded teams in the area’s largest division is the North Adams Green Devils (20-0).
North Adams, the No. 1 seed, will await the winner of No. 25 Ironton (4-17) and No. 24 West Union (6-14) — who meet in a sectional semifinal on Feb. 15, at 1 p.m. on Feb. 18 in a sectional championship.

Also receiving first-round byes is No. 2 West (19-1), No. 3 Wheelersburg (17-2), No. 4 Eastern Brown (18-3), No. 5 Adena (16-3), No. 6 Rock Hill (16-5), No. 7 Fairfield (13-5) and No. 8 Portsmouth (15-5).
The Senators will host the winner of No. 26 Westfall (5-15) and No. 23 Wellston (6-12), the Pirates will host either Belpre or No. 22 South Point (5-11), the Warriors will host No. 28 Northwest (3-15) or No. 21 Southeastern (8-10), Adena will have Crooksville or River Valley, the Redwomen will entertain Alexander or Federal Hocking, Fairfield will play host to No. 31 Zane Trace (0-20) or No. 18 Huntington (9-10), and Portsmouth will meet with Meigs or No. 32 Oak Hill (0-18).
All of the above games are sectional championships matchups, slated for 1 p.m. on Feb. 18.
Also in Division III, No. 13 Piketon (13-7) makes a trip to No. 12 Lynchburg-Clay (11-8), No. 14 Peebles (13-8) goes to No. 11 Minford (12-6), No. 15 South Webster (11-9) visits No. 10 Chesapeake (14-6) and No. 16 Coal Grove (11-10) pays a visit to No. 9 Nelsonville-York (15-4).
Those games are also sectional championship matchups and will also be at 1 p.m. on Feb. 18.
In the Central District, No. 7 Amanda-Clearcreek (11-8) will host the Columbus School for Girls at 7 p.m., Feb. 14 in a sectional semifinal.
DIVISION IV
In Division IV, No. 1 Notre Dame (17-1) will host the winner of No. 17 Manchester (2-15) and No. 16 Ironton St. Joe (3-14) on Feb. 15 in a sectional title game. The Greyhounds will meet with the Flyers on Feb. 13.
Paint Valley (11-7) is a No. 4 seed and will host Trimble, No. 9 New Boston (10-8) will travel to No. 8 Valley (6-10) that same evening, and No. 12 Eastern (4-15) goes to Eastern Meigs. All of those sectional championship matchups are scheduled to tip at 7 p.m. on Feb. 15.
Elsewhere in sectional title games, No. 10 Clay (8-10) makes a trip to No. 7 Symmes Valley (11-9) and No. 11 Western (5-11) travels to No. 6 Whiteoak (12-9) on Feb. 15.
Miller will travel to No. 15 Green (5-11) for a sectional semifinal at 7 p.m., Feb. 13, while No. 19 East (3-15) travels to Southern that same evening.
